WoOsH said:
as the subject. i have read another thread that says its just 2 rose jointed track rod ends, is this right?
That is essentially what it is but, the kit also includes the rods for the bearing of the rosejoint to attach to the steering arm (not track arm). These are tapered at the steering arm end for fit and have been engineered to give enough clearance to the rosejoint to allow complete movement as necessary !
